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from St Margarets (London) to Llangammarch start from as little as £29.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from St Margarets (London) to Llangammarch start from £102.50 one way, or £103.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from St Margarets (London) to Llangammarch are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Everything you need to know about Llangammarch Station

Discovering Llangammarch Train Station

Nestled in the scenic Powys region of Wales, Llangammarch train station offers a unique charm that's hard to find anywhere else. This quaint station caters to those looking for a peaceful getaway from bustling city life. As a vital stop on the Heart of Wales Line, it provides an essential link between rural communities and larger urban areas. Planning a trip to or from Llangammarch? Let us guide you through what to expect at this modest yet important station.

Facilities and Services at Llangammarch

Llangammarch station is unstaffed, which means there’s no ticket office or ticket machines available. It's important to plan ahead and purchase your tickets online if you’re starting your journey here. Although smartcards and validators are not an option at this station, an induction loop is present for those requiring auditory assistance. The absence of other amenities like wa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ities hints at the station's minimalistic setup. Nevertheless, there is a seating area where you can take a breather while waiting for your train. For those who drive, the car park maintained by Transport for Wales offers four spaces and one accessible option, free of charge.

Accessibility and Support

The station provides step-free access to the platform via a slight slope from the car park, categorized as B1, offering some accessibility to travelers with reduced mobility. While it lacks facilities such as accessible toilets or ticket machines, the platform is accessible and there is a ramp available for train access. For assistance, it's recommended to arrange for support in advance through the Passenger Assist service, ensuring a smooth journey for those requiring extra help.
